Java SE Development Kit (JDK) 应用程序开发包 24.0.0

资源介绍

JDK 是 Windows 上一款 Oracle 提供的一套用于开发 Java 应用程序的开发包,它提供编译,运行 java 程序所需要的各种工具和资源,包括Java编译器,Java 运行时环境,以及常用的 Java 类库等。自从 Java 推出以来,JDK 已经成为使用最广泛的 Java SDK(Software development kit)。

JDK 和 JRE 区别:普通(最终)用户或者学习者安装 JRE(Java 运行环境)即可。JDK (Java 开发工具包)包含JRE,如果你不知如何选择,可以使用 JDK。

  • Java 编译器(javac)将 Java 源代码(.java 文件)编译为字节码(.class 文件),是开发流程的关键工具。
  • Java 虚拟机(JVM)执行字节码的运行环境,负责内存管理、垃圾回收和跨平台支持。
  • Java 运行时环境(JRE)包含 JVM 和运行 Java 程序所需的类库,是 JDK 的子集。
  • 调试器(jdb):用于定位和修复代码中的错误。
  • 文档工具(javadoc):从源代码注释生成 API 文档。
  • 打包工具(jar):将多个类文件和资源打包为 JAR 文件。
  • 性能分析工具(jstat、jmap、jconsole 等):监控和优化 Java 程序性能。
  • 安全工具(keytool、jarsigner):管理密钥、证书和数字签名。
  • Java API(类库)提供丰富的预定义类和接口,涵盖字符串处理、集合框架、网络编程、多线程等功能。
  • 代码开发与编译,通过javac编译器将人类可读的 Java 代码转换为字节码,便于跨平台运行。
  • 调试与测试,使用jdb或集成开发环境(IDE)进行断点调试,结合单元测试框架(如 JUnit)验证代码逻辑。
  • 文档生成,通过javadoc工具自动生成 API 文档,提高代码可维护性和协作效率。
  • 性能优化,利用性能分析工具监控内存使用、线程状态和方法调用,优化程序性能。
  • 安全管理,通过keytool生成密钥和证书,使用jarsigner对 JAR 文件进行数字签名,确保代码安全性。

资源截图

Java SE Development Kit (JDK) 应用程序开发包

Java SE Development Kit (JDK) 应用程序开发包 24.0.0

最新版本 5544_24.0.0 更新时间 2025年7月17日 帮助说明 点此获取口令,开通会员、免口令、无限制。
(0)
上一篇 2025年7月17日 15:16
下一篇 2025年7月17日 15:20

相关推荐

扫码领红包